Abstract

Trajectory similarity measure is an important factor in Ship trajectory clustering, its design influences the number and shape of the cluster. In order to design a trajectory similarity measure appropriate for ship trajectory clustering. The author of this paper proposed an improved trajectory similarity measure based on symmetrized segment-path short (SSPD), it calculates the distance in time series and enhance the weight of endpoints, solves the problem of SSPD cannot identify trajectory direction and endpoints inconsistent. To prove that the improved trajectory similarity measure performs better than other similarity measures, the author designed two experiments. In the first experiment, two similar ship trajectories were selected, then change their sampling rate, point position, trajectory length and trajectory direction, compared with other trajectory similarity measures, observe the distance change. In the second experiment, based on real Automatic Identification System data, the improved SSPD is compared with Dynamic Time Warping on ship trajectory clustering. Experiment shows the improved SSPD can get a better clustering result.
